第一種 第二種 第三種 ...
前言: 這周在寫一個小項目,雖然小但是是純調外部接口的,調完了接口還不停的循環接口返回的數據 已轉換JSONArray ,然后再判斷值,再做不同處理,關鍵是數據量還比較大,這剛做完還沒開始上線,測試也還沒開始測呢,就想着自己先看看每個方法運行效率,省的數據大了項目掛掉 循環判斷好多,有時還有 個for嵌套循環 ,就是純粹在時間上進行監測,沒有內存和cpu的監控。 主要利用了Spring AOP 技 ...
2014-11-16 16:20 2 19342 推薦指數:
第一種 第二種 第三種 ...
3.把start放在想測試運行時間的那一部分前: start1 = clock(); ...
Python 社區有句俗語: “python自己帶着電池” ,別自己寫計時框架。 Python3.2具備一個叫做 timeit 的完美計時工具可以測量python代碼的運行時間。 timeit 模塊: timeit 模塊定義了接受兩個參數的 Timer 類。兩個參數都是字符串。 第一個參數 ...
1、了解輸入數據的量和運行時間的關系 使用相同的算法,輸入數據的量不同,運行時間也會不同。比如對10個數字排序和對1000000個數字排序,很容易想到就是后者運行時間更長。實際上會長多少呢?后者是前者的100倍,還是1000000倍?不僅需要理解不同算法在運行時間上的區別,也要了解根據輸入數據量 ...
在寫代碼中,有時候我們需要評估某段代碼或者函數的執行時間;方法就是在該段代碼或者函數前面,記錄一個時間T1,在代碼段或函數后面記錄時間T2,那其運行時間就是T2-T1; 就是簡單的減法!!! 那具體的實現方法呢?我這里有兩個,給大家參考: 一,clock(); clock()是C/C++中 ...
aop的before和after,尋思分別在兩個方法里獲得當前時間,最后一減就可以了。 因此,今天就探討了一下這個問題,和大家分享一下。 創建maven工程,引入spring的依賴包,配置好applicationContext-aop.xml,如下: <?xml version ...
呀,來,互相傷害 此外,我也對 console 產生了一點興趣就去測試了更多它的方法,列幾個個人最近 ...
早期測速的時候是這樣的,呵呵呵,一開始還挺爽的 function testFunctionTime(fn) { var start = new Date().getTime(); if ...